Abstract

PURPOSE: To provide excellent composite contact material through internal oxidation method, by treatment of an alloy contg. principally Ag-Bi under specific conditions.
CONSTITUTION: Molten metal of an alloy contg. principally Ag-Bi is cast to ingot, which is pulverized to small scaly pieces, then it is compressed in a metallic die to give a molded item of voidage 5W10%. The item is pressure-molded at a temp. not lower then 700°C and lower than 825°C in oxidizing atmosphere to a voidage not higher than 2%. The item is further heated and sintered, and is subjected to extrusion and drawing repeatedly in order to increase the strength and density of the material, thus producing contact material.
